All staff and students are being asked to look after themselves and others as the University returns for Michaelmas term. A range of guidance has been developed, reminding us of our personal and collective responsibility for keeping the University and local community safe. In particular:

  • Keep your distance
  • Wash your hands
  • Wear a face covering
  • Got symptoms? Get a test
  • Contacted by track and trace? Stay at home

Information about the guidance is now available on the coronavirus health pages, and a short video has also been produced. The materials have been developed with input from the University’s medical and behavioural experts, and in consultation with staff and students across the collegiate University.  All students and offer holders have been made aware of the campaign via student and offer holder newsletters.
